Buttermilk Falls

One of the tallest waterfalls in the Adirondacks at over 100 feet, accessed by a very short walk from the parking area. A wooden staircase climbs alongside the falls with viewing platforms at multiple levels, giving kids a front-row look at the cascading water from top to bottom. The ease of access makes this perfect for families with young children. The falls are most impressive in spring after snowmelt but remain scenic all summer. A short trail continues to the Raquette River above the falls.

Pixley Falls State Park

A small roadside state park with a short trail to a 50-foot waterfall on Lansing Kill Creek. The walk to the falls is just a few hundred yards from the parking lot making it one of the easiest waterfall hikes in the state. The falls cascade over a wide rock ledge into a rocky pool below. A picnic area with tables and grills makes it easy to turn the quick waterfall visit into a longer outing. The park is a perfect rest stop on the way to or from the Adirondacks. No swimming is allowed but the falls are beautiful to watch.

Rainbow Falls (Waianuenue)

An 80-foot waterfall in the heart of Hilo that drops into a circular pool surrounded by a cave and tropical vegetation. The falls are visible from a paved overlook just steps from the parking lot making it one of the easiest waterfall viewpoints in Hawaii. On sunny mornings, rainbows form in the mist at the base of the falls, which is how it got its name. A short trail leads to the top of the falls through a grove of enormous banyan trees. The whole visit takes 15 to 30 minutes. A perfect quick stop in Hilo.

Wailua Falls

A dramatic 173-foot double waterfall visible from a roadside overlook that requires zero hiking. You may recognize it from the opening credits of Fantasy Island. The twin falls plunge into a deep pool surrounded by lush tropical vegetation and the view from the overlook is spectacular. After heavy rain the falls can merge into one massive cascade. This is the easiest big waterfall experience on Kauai and perfect for families with young children or limited mobility. The whole visit takes 10 to 15 minutes from car to car.
